前提你要把junit.jar加到cp中
然后执行 java junit.swingui.TestRunner
你可以编写许多testCase,如果一次执行多个testCase可以创建testSuite,为了执行testSuite你需要使用testRunner;
(1) testCase(测试用例)
(2) testSuite(测试集合)
(3) testRunner(测试运行器)--执行 testSuite 实际继承BaseTestRunner
Cactus框架就是继承BaseTestRunner,当然你也可以定义自已的testRunner 继承BaseTestRunner.
(4) testResult(测试结果)
Exception in thread "main" java.lang.SecurityException: Prohibited package name: java.junitbook.sampling 错误:是因为禁用的包名.java和javax是java专用的.不能随便使用.这个约束已经嵌入到java底层API了.在ClassLoader中.
更改一下就行了..在junit in action中第三章就出现这个错误,现在已经搞定
- 大小: 858.9 KB
分享到:
相关推荐
在不确定上下文相关的环境中,图形用户界面测试主要依靠随机测试以及测试人员的从业经验,其有效性低。提高图形用户界面测试的效率是一个未解难题。因此,通过引入离散并行系统的Petri网理论,定义了图形用户界面的...
本书《图形用户界面测试自动化》提出了全新的测试GUI的方法,旨在让测试人员不必再手工编写测试脚本,从而能够更加专注于测试计划和测试策略的设计,提升测试的整体效率和覆盖率。 GUI测试自动化是指利用自动化工具...
移动APP测试是一个复杂的过程,涉及到多个方面的测试,包括图形用户界面测试、系统测试、基础模块测试等。随着移动互联网的迅猛发展,移动APP的应用逐渐深入,版本更新速度快,留给测试人员的时间非常有限,难以在短...
在MATLAB中,图形用户界面(GUI)是一种强大的工具,用于创建交互式的应用程序,使得用户可以通过图形化的元素如按钮、菜单、文本框等与程序进行交互。GUI在数据分析、科学计算以及复杂应用的演示中非常有用,特别是...
Qt/E mbedded图形用户界面移植与开发主要包括:使用Qt/E mbedded开发图形用户界面、移植图形用户界面到嵌入式Linux平台、在目标平台上进行应用程序的测试和调试等方面。 五、结论 本文主要介绍了基于嵌入式Linux...
在IT领域,图形用户界面(GUI,Graphical User Interface)是软件与用户交互的主要方式,它的创建对于初学者来说是一项重要的技能。GUI使得用户能够通过图标、菜单、按钮等直观的元素来操作软件,而非使用复杂的...
图形用户界面测试用例是指对软件系统的图形用户界面的测试,旨在验证软件系统的图形用户界面是否能够满足用户的需求和期望。图形用户界面测试用例应当包括测试对象的介绍、测试范围与目的、测试环境与测试辅助工具的...
该模板涵盖了多种类型的测试,包括接口-路径测试、功能测试、健壮性测试、性能测试、图形用户界面测试、信息安全性测试、压力测试、可靠性测试和安装/反安装测试。 接口-路径测试 接口-路径测试是软件测试中的一种...
Linux QT图形用户界面编程是将开源的QT框架与Linux操作系统相结合,用于开发高效、美观且跨平台的桌面应用。QT库提供了丰富的API和工具,使得开发者可以构建功能强大的应用程序,而Linux作为开源操作系统,提供了...
### 实验七-Java实验报告-Swing图形用户界面 #### 实验背景与目的 本次实验是基于《Java面向对象程序设计》课程中的一个实践环节,旨在通过实际操作加深对Swing图形用户界面的理解与掌握。实验的具体目的是让学生...
Java图形用户界面(GUI)设计是开发交互式应用程序的关键部分,它允许用户通过可视化的组件与软件进行互动。在Java中,我们可以利用多种库和工具来创建GUI,其中最常见的是Java AWT(Abstract Window Toolkit)和...
在IT行业中,Visual C++是一种强大的编程环境,尤其在创建图形用户界面(GUI)应用程序方面。这个指南将深入探讨如何利用Visual C++进行GUI开发,帮助开发者构建功能丰富的、交互性强的应用程序。以下是对"Visual ...
在Windows 7环境下,iperf通常以命令行形式运行,但本资源提供了一个图形用户界面(GUI)版本,使得操作更加直观和简单,更适合非技术背景的用户。 1. **iperf的基本概念** - **iperf类型**: iperf分为iperf2和...
### Visual C++图形用户界面开发指南 #### 一、引言 在计算机软件开发领域,图形用户界面(GUI)的设计与实现是极为重要的一个环节。它不仅关系到用户体验的好坏,还直接影响着软件产品的市场竞争力。《Visual C++...
本项目“JAVA实现学生信息管理系统+图形用户界面(GUI)”是利用Java技术实现的一个实用系统,它结合了后端逻辑处理和前端用户交互,为管理学生信息提供了一个直观、便捷的平台。以下将详细介绍该系统的相关知识点: ...
在IT领域,图形用户界面(GUI)开发与测试是至关重要的环节,因为它直接影响到软件产品的用户体验和易用性。GUI不仅需要美观,更需要高效、直观且无障碍。下面将详细探讨这一主题。 首先,界面设计指南是GUI开发的...
《图形用户界面(GUI)开发与测试》是一本深入探讨GUI设计与测试的资源包,其中包含NXPowerLite软件的相关信息。GUI(图形用户界面)是计算机系统与用户交互的主要方式,它通过图形元素如窗口、按钮、菜单和图标等使...
嵌入式基本图形库设计及图形用户界面实现 嵌入式基本图形库设计及图形用户界面实现是基于嵌入式 Linux 系统的帧缓冲技术,调用编译图片的静、动态库从而设计出一个基本的图形库,实现的图形库的具备的功能类似 ...
在本文中,我们还讨论了图形用户界面的设计和实现过程,包括图形用户界面的需求分析、设计、实现和测试等步骤。我们还讨论了图形用户界面的优点和缺点,例如提高用户体验、简化操作步骤等优点,以及增加系统资源占用...